Program Overview

The Speech-Language Pathology Graduate School Preparation (SLPGSP) undergraduate certificate is designed for students who have completed, or are in the process of completing, a bachelor's degree in a non-CSD major and are seeking a pathway to fulfill the prerequisite courses required for admission to a graduate degree program and enter the workforce as a speech-language pathologist.


Program Details

Eligibility

The SLPGSP certificate is not eligible for financial aid unless the student is enrolled in another degree program (another major at the university).


Application Process

To apply to the Grad Prep certificate, students should use the university's first year or transfer applications. The non-degree application should not be completed.


Program Structure

The SLPGSP certificate is designed to provide students with the necessary prerequisite courses to pursue a graduate degree in speech-language pathology.
